Owners choose euthanasia for their animals for a variety of reasons, including prevention of suffering from a terminal ill-ness, their inability to care for the animal, the impact of the animal’s condition on other animals or people, and/or financial considerations. Veterinarians provide a wide range of services in private practice, teaching, research, government service, public health, military service 8.2 Euthanasia is not, in law, an act of veterinary surgery, and in most circumstances may be carried out anyone provided that it is carried out humanely. No veterinary surgeon is obliged to kill a healthy animal unless required to do so under statutory powers as part of their conditions of employment. This site is like a library, Use search … After the pet’s actual death, the owner’s feelings about the animal’s ultimate disposal vary greatly. Preferences tend to be based on experiences with the death of human loved ones. Options for disposing of an animal’s body might be well-known to veterinarians, but they are probably not well-known to most pet owners.
